BMW X5 2015 F15 Owners Manual Minimum tread depth
Wear indicators are distributed around the
tires circumference and have the legally re‐
quired minimum height of 0.063 in/1.6 mm.
They are marked on the side of the tire with
TW

BMW X5 2015 F15 Owners Manual After the wheel change1.Tighten the lug bolts crosswise. The tight‐
ening torque is 101 lb ft/140 Nm.2.Stow the nonworking wheel in the trunk.
The nonworking wheel cannot be stored
